House Bill 20-1230 Summary
-
Extends the sunset date for the Occupational Therapy Practice Act from September 1, 2020 to September 1, 2030, allowing continued licensing of occupational therapists and assistants in Colorado.
-
Expands the definition of occupational therapy practice to include behavioral health care services, telehealth/telerehabilitation services, low vision rehabilitation, sensory-based interventions, and services to groups and populations.
-
Adds new definitions for key terms including "client," "occupation," "functional cognition," and "behavioral health care services" to modernize the regulatory framework.
-
Clarifies that occupational therapists may make occupational therapy diagnoses within their scope of practice and allows qualified out-of-state therapists to provide services on behalf of temporarily absent licensed therapists.
-
Adds new grounds for discipline including failure to maintain proper client records, health insurance abuse, and fraudulent insurance acts; reorganizes and streamlines disciplinary procedures and notice requirements.
